Tag: microsoft chart controls

Microsoft .NET图表控件 – 使用矩形选择点

使用.NET 4.0 Chart控件将具有X,Y值的数据绘制为散点图 。 我相信微软图表控件是从Dundas获得的。 我想使用类似于用于缩放图表的矩形的橡皮筋矩形在图表上选择点 。 (当单击第一个鼠标按钮时,它会建立矩形的一个角,当鼠标移动时,将重绘半透明矩形,直到释放鼠标为止)。 有没有办法覆盖缩放方法来创建选择而不是放大? 可以将叠加层放置在现有图表上,以捕获鼠标并显示透明矩形吗? 我通常喜欢用我的问题发布示例代码,但在这种情况下我不知道从哪里开始。 链接到文档,其他教程或示例代码中的正确位置将不胜感激。

如何使用鼠标滚轮启用Microsoft图表控件缩放

我在我的项目中使用Microsoft Chart控件,我想通过使用鼠标滚轮在Chart Control中启用缩放function,我该如何实现? 但是用户不必点击图表,应该就像鼠标位置在我的图表上而不是从鼠标滚轮滚动它可以放大/缩小

在Microsoft图表控件中启用鼠标滚轮缩放

如何使用鼠标滚轮启用Microsoft图表控件缩放 我有以下代码,我需要知道如何制作此活动? 在哪个class级.. private void chData_MouseWheel(object sender, MouseEventArgs e) { try { if (e.Delta 0) { double xMin = chart1.ChartAreas[0].AxisX.ScaleView.ViewMinimum; double xMax = chart1.ChartAreas[0].AxisX.ScaleView.ViewMaximum; double yMin = chart1.ChartAreas[0].AxisY.ScaleView.ViewMinimum; double yMax = chart1.ChartAreas[0].AxisY.ScaleView.ViewMaximum; double posXStart = chart1.ChartAreas[0].AxisX.PixelPositionToValue(e.Location.X) – (xMax – xMin) / 4; double posXFinish = chart1.ChartAreas[0].AxisX.PixelPositionToValue(e.Location.X) + (xMax – xMin) / 4; double posYStart = […]

Winforms图表:如何启用背景色标

我正在寻找一种在Winform图表控件库中启用自定义背景色标的方法。 这是一个例子: 在背景中看到绿色,黄色和红色? 现在,我需要一种通过控制开始/结束Y值,颜色本身以及不同颜色的数量来自定义背景色标的方法。 提前致谢!